People often are that gullible.
Don't think it is just Scandinavian.

We've got ads here, warning people not to tell everything.
Every time I do my banking online, I get told not to give my codes to anyone.
Lots of time banks send out warnings how they never ask for a pin-code via phone or email. Apparently plenty of people just give that, when asked by someone appearing to be an authority.
Gullible, very gullible.
